As the topic title says, Be-Pachi Music is a BMS Player I made in Delphi 7. It supports BMS and BME files, and supports both 5-key and 7-key single-player songs, through the use of an option on the Start-Up Config window (System>BMS File Type).

Be-Pachi Music will most likely be an eternal 'Work in Progress', and I'll keep trying to update this on a regular basis.



BPM is now version 0.0641, and even though plenty of new things have been added, all themes from the v0.05x versions are fully compatible with this newest version. Ah.

BMS defines certain core functionality (it can even be used for DDR songs, for example). BME adds some tweaks to basically make 7-key support possible. (I put up a summary of the basics a while ago at http://sacredchao.net/~arashi/bme.txt a year or two ago.) There are tons of "extensions" of the BMS format that various Japanese players have made over the years, though, that I've just started learning about tonight; there are almost 60 commands that can occur in the header, and something like 80 useful play channels defined. There's even long note support for EZ2DJ-like charts, but it looks like only one player I've never heard of supports it.
